Pasture fence repair services focus on restoring and maintaining fences that enclose agricultural land, pastures, or large properties. These services typically involve fixing broken or damaged fence posts, replacing worn-out or missing wire, repairing sagging or leaning sections, and ensuring that gates and hardware function properly. The goal is to create a secure boundary that keeps livestock safely contained while preventing unwanted animals or trespassers from entering the property. Local contractors experienced in pasture fence repair understand the specific needs of rural and agricultural properties, ensuring that repairs are durable and suited to the terrain and climate.
Many problems can arise with pasture fences over time, especially in areas with harsh weather or frequent livestock activity. Common issues include posts that have rotted or been knocked over, wire that has become saggy or broken, and sections that have become detached or fallen into disrepair. These problems can lead to animals escaping, which poses safety risks and potential property damage. Additionally, damaged fences can compromise property boundaries, making it difficult to manage land effectively. Repair services help address these issues quickly, restoring the integrity of the fence and reducing the risk of further damage or animal escape.

The overview below groups typical Pasture Fence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in State College, PA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for routine fence patching or replacing a few damaged posts usually range from $250-$600. Many minor j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of the work needed.
Medium-Sized Projects - replacing several sections of fencing or repairing larger damaged areas generally costs between $1,000-$3,000. These projects are common for property owners seeking to restore significant portions of their pasture fences.
Full Fence Replacement - installing a new fence across a large pasture can range from $4,000-$8,000+, with larger, more complex projects potentially reaching $10,000 or more. Fewer projects fall into this highest tier, typically involving extensive work or premium materials.
Material & Design Variations - costs can vary based on the type of fencing material chosen, with wood, vinyl, or wire options affecting the overall price. Local contractors can provide estimates tailored to specific materials and design preferences, which influence the final cost range.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of pasture fence repairs do local contractors handle? Local service providers can address issues such as broken or leaning fence posts, damaged wire or mesh, gate repairs, and overall fence reinforcement to maintain pasture boundaries.
How can I tell if my pasture fence needs repair? Signs include sagging or broken fencing, gaps or holes, leaning posts, or damage caused by weather or animals, indicating that repairs may be needed.
Are there different fencing materials that local contractors work with? Yes, service providers commonly work with wood, wire, vinyl, and metal fencing materials, depending on the specific needs of the pasture.
What are common causes of pasture fence damage? Damage can result from weather conditions, animal activity, fallen trees or branches, and general wear over time, which local pros can assess and repair.
How do local contractors typically approach pasture fence repairs? They evaluate the existing fence, identify damaged areas, and perform necessary repairs or replacements to restore fencing integrity and function.
